摘要:

矿山物联网的蓬勃发展要求从顶层着眼规划矿山物联网科技。对国家安全生产监督管理总局于 2017年编制完成的“矿山物联网科技顶层设计”进行解读,从设计思路、发展现状、面临挑战、战略目标、需要突破的核心关键技术、实施路线与保障等方面入手,分析顶层设计的技术背景和核心内容,为矿山行业科研工作者和科技管理者阅读、理解和使用“顶层设计”提供一定借鉴。

Abstract:

The flourishing development of the mine network requires the technology of the mine Internet of things from the top layer.The top layer design mine networking technology completed in 2017 by the State Administration of Production Safety Supervision was read.From the aspects of the design ideas,development status,challenges,strategic objectives,the key technology and implementation route and security needed,the technical background and core contents of top layer design were analyzed.It will provide some references for researchers and technology managers in mining industry to read,understand and use “top layer design”.
